Output cdbd77a4e674608a49d71c4ab457372f399eb220e4bcd216c7263ae14ff8aa52:10

value
102578890
script pubkey
OP_0 OP_PUSHBYTES_32 13a85c2b92f06eb11605abe914e6a7173cc0e97c7381af39283beb0c793589ab
address
bc1qzw59c2uj7phtz9s94053fe48zu7vp6tuwwq67wfg804sc7f43x4slrgtg4
transaction
cdbd77a4e674608a49d71c4ab457372f399eb220e4bcd216c7263ae14ff8aa52
confirmations
643
spent
true